Reach The Sky - Friends, Lies, and the End of the World


Reach The Sky - Friends, Lies, and the End of the World

Album Details

  • Artist: Reach The Sky
  • Album: Friends, Lies, and the End of the World
  • Label: Victory
  • Year of Release: 2001
  • ME Rating: 3.5 out of 5
  • Reviewed by: dscanland on 2003-03-29

Reach the Sky's fans are totally rabid and I had yet to figure out what all the fuss was about. Now I know. These guys play a blistering mix of punk and hardcore (a bit more of the latter) and it's not even that original but the big draw here is the talent that the band possesses. Ian Larrabee has no problem adapting his vocals to whatever the song demands. The band as a whole is not afraid to throw a little emotion into the mix (take for instance "Stars Lead The Way") but they never wimp out on us. For only their second full length, the band sounds quite mature and has figured out how to mix all their influences into a hardcore soup that tastes homemade. Reach The Sky is a band that means every lyric that they sing out and to top it off, their talented too.
